Desarrollo impulsado por la comunidad: Introduciendo OP Stack Mods

OP Labs está emocionado de comenzar a destacar los OP Stack Mods, modificaciones o mejoras al OP Stack creadas por miembros de las comunidades de Optimism y Ethereum, para recibir retroalimentación de la comunidad.

El software libre y de código abierto es el corazón latente del ecosistema Ethereum. La capacidad de ejecutar y modificar sistemas de software compartidos sin la necesidad de permisos es una fuerza impulsora clave detrás de toda la industria cripto. Estos mismos principios fundamentales guiaron el diseño de OP Stack, el código fuente de código abierto con licencia MIT que impulsa a Optimism Collective. Si puedes soñarlo, puedes construirlo con OP Stack.

Debido a que el OP Stack es modular y completamente sin permisos, los desarrolladores de todo el ecosistema Ethereum están empezando a crear interesantes modificaciones a OP Stack por sí mismos. OP Labs no siempre tiene la capacidad de llevar estas adiciones a producción, pero como cualquier ecosistema verdaderamente descentralizado, la capacidad de un equipo para revisar no debería ser un factor limitante para la inclusión en el OP Stack. Es por eso que estamos emocionados de comenzar a destacar algunas de las posibles adiciones al OP Stack, que llamamos OP Stack Mods, y están siendo construidas por los desarrolladores en nuestra comunidad.

Entendiendo OP Stack Mods

El OP Stack Mod es una modificación o mejora del OP Stack creado por los miembros de las comunidades de Ethereum y Optimism, los cuáles OP Labs encuentra destacando para obtener retroalimentación de la comunidad. Destacando estos Mods queremos asegurar que los desarrolladores de OP Stack reciban comentarios prácticos del mundo real sobre las herramientas que han creado, lo que eventualmente necesitarán para implementar una modificación en producción.

Los Mods de OP Stack son similares a versiones beta de un producto, pero no tienen garantizado llegar a formar parte de OP Stack. Los Mods que satisfacen una necesidad concreta dentro del ecosistema Superchain podrían llegar a formar parte de la OP Stack en un futuro, pero necesitarán tus comentarios para alcanzar ese punto.

Presentando una interfaz de Disponibilidad de Datos Modular: Un Mod de OP Stack creado por Celestia Labs

Como parte de este anuncio, estamos felices de compartir que Celestia Labs ha estado trabajando en un OP Stack Mod que pondría la capa de disponibilidad de datos (DA) del stack detrás de una interfaz más modular.

El próximo lanzamiento Bedrock de OP Stack ha preparado el camino para la modularización de varios componentes de OP Stack, como las capas de prueba y ejecución del Stack. Basándose en esto, Celestia Labs ha creado de manera independiente una modificación experimental que modulariza la capa DA del Stack al separarla de la capa de ordenación.

Aunque cadenas como OP Mainnet seguirán confiando en las sólidas propiedades de DA proporcionadas por Ethereum, una interfaz de DA abstracta abre la puerta para que nuevas cadenas sean construidas utilizando OP Stack y alojen los datos de la cadena en la plataforma que mejor se adapte a las necesidades de la cadena. Esto ampliaría aún más los tipos de aplicaciones que podrían hacer un uso serio a la blockchain.

Esta interfaz propuesta seguiría utilizando Ethereum por sus propiedades de consenso y ordenación, mientras que al mismo tiempo permitiría a las cadenas utilizar otros proveedores de disponibilidad de datos, como Data Availability Committees o Celestia, dependiendo de las propiedades de seguridad deseadas por cada cadena. Para obtener una descripción más amplia de la interfaz propuesta consulte la visión técnica de Celestia Labs.

Celestia Labs ha proporcionado el siguiente diagrama para demostrar cómo esta interfaz puede utilizarse para separa DA y la ordenación:

Proporciona comentarios sobre la Interfaz DA Modular

Celestia Labs busca tus comentarios sobre su Interfaz DA Modular. Han proporcionado la documentación para una integración demo de su interfaz propuesta que utiliza Celestia como proveedor de DA. Para que la interfaz sea considerada para su inclusión en OP Stack, debe ser capaz de admitir diversos tipos de proveedores de disponibilidad de datos.

Si estás interesado en poner a prueba de estrés una integración existente, Celestia Labs ha proporcionado amablemente la documentación de ejemplo para ejecutar tu propia cadena de OP Stack modificada que publica los datos en una red de desarrollo local de Celestia. Publicar transacciones de manera agresiva en este sistema puede ayudar a señalar problemas en la conexión entre el proveedor de DA y Ethereum.

Si estás interesado en ampliar las capacidades de OP Stack para admitir proveedores de DA adicionales, sería especialmente útil intentar integrar tu propio proveedor de DA utilizando la interfaz propuesta. Los problemas que puedas encontrar durante este proceso de integración serán comentarios muy valiosos para el equipo de Celestia Labs. Nos interesa especialmente las integraciones con el Data Availability Committee, así como enfoques más experimentales que alojen datos en otras blockchains que normalmente no se usan para este propósito, como Bitcoin.

Ayuda a potenciar OP Stack

Los Mods de OP Stack son un testimonio del poder y el potencial de stacks de software de código abierto. Estos Mods no solo fomentan soluciones creativas, sino que también muestran el espíritu de la descentralización. Estamos emocionados de avanzar rápidamente hacia un futuro en el que la mayoría del desarrollo en OP Stack sea impulsado por la innovación sin permisos dentro de las comunidades de Optimism y Ethereum.

OP Labs destacará más OP Stack Mods a medida que aparezcan y estén listos para una revisión más amplia. Si tienes una idea novedosa o deseas trabajar para potenciar OP Stack, te invitamos a disfrutar desarrollando OP Stack y lanzando tus propios OP Stack Mods. ¡Cuando estés listo para comentar, aquí estaremos! Después de todo, tu contribución podría dar forma al futuro del Optimism Collective. 🔴✨

Subscribe to Optimism Español
Receive the latest updates directly to your inbox.
Mint this entry as an NFT to add it to your collection.
Verification
This entry has been permanently stored onchain and signed by its creator.